The Fujita scale rates tornadoes by damage caused and has been replaced in some countries by the updated Enhanced Fujita Scale. An F0 or EF0 tornado, the weakest category, damages trees, but not substantial structures. An F5 or EF5 tornado, the strongest category, rips buildings off their foundations and can deform large skyscrapers.
The similar TORRO scale ranges from T0 for extremely weak tornadoes to T11 for the most powerful known tornadoes.
Doppler radar data, photogrammetry, and ground swirl patterns (trochoidal marks) may also be analyzed to determine intensity and assign a rating.

Originally it taxed a person's income regardless of who was beneficially entitled to that income, but now tax is paid on income to which the taxpayer is beneficially entitled. Most companies were taken out of the income tax net in 1965 when corporation tax was introduced. These changes were consolidated by the Income and Corporation Taxes Act 1970. Also the schedules under which tax is levied have changed. Schedule B was abolished in 1988, Schedule C in 1996 and Schedule E in 2003. For income tax purposes, the remaining schedules were superseded by the Income Tax (Trading and Other Income) Act 2005, which also repealed Schedule F. For corporation tax purposes, the Schedular system was repealed and superseded by the Corporation Tax Acts of 2009 and 2010. The highest rate of income tax peaked in the Second World War at 99.25%. This was slightly reduced after the war and was around 97.5 percent (nineteen shillings and sixpence in the pound) through the 1950s and 60s.

In 1971, the top rate of income tax on earned income was cut to 75%. A surcharge of 15% on investment income kept the overall top rate on that income at 90%. In 1974 the top tax rate on earned income was again raised, to 83%. With the investment income surcharge this raised the overall top rate on investment income to 98%, the highest permanent rate since the war. This applied to incomes over £20,000 (equivalent to £221,741 in 2021 terms),. In 1974, as many as 750,000 people were liable to pay the top rate of income tax. Margaret Thatcher, who favoured indirect taxation, reduced personal income tax rates during the 1980s. In the first budget after her election victory in 1979, the top rate was reduced from 83% to 60% and the basic rate from 33% to 30%. The basic rate was further cut in three subsequent budgets, to 29% in 1986 budget, 27% in 1987 and 25% in 1988. The top rate of income tax was cut to 40% in the 1988 budget. The investment income surcharge was abolished in 1985.
Subsequent governments reduced the basic rate further, to the present level of 20% in 2007. Since 1976 (when it stood at 35%), the basic rate has been reduced by 15%, but this reduction has been largely offset by increases in national insurance contributions and value added tax.
In 2010 a new top rate of 50% was introduced on income over £150,000. Revenue to the Exchequer subsequently went down as top rate earners found methods to avoid taxation. In the 2012 budget this rate was cut to 45% for 2013–14; this was followed by an increase in the tax paid by additional rate taxpayers from £38 billion to £46 billion. Chancellor George Osborne claimed that the lower, more competitive tax rate had caused the increase.
In September 2022 the government announced that from April 2023 the top rate of tax would be reduced from 45% to 40% and the basic rate reduced from 20% to 19%. The abolition of the 45% additional rate of tax was subsequently cancelled through measures set out in the 2022's Autumn statement.

In a linear economy, natural resources are turned into products that are ultimately destined to become waste because of the way they have been designed and manufactured. This process is often summarized by "take, make, waste". By contrast, a circular economy employs reuse, sharing, repair, refurbishment, remanufacturing and recycling to create a closed-loop system, reducing the use of resource inputs and the creation of waste, pollution and carbon emissions. The circular economy aims to keep products, materials, equipment and infrastructure in use for longer, thus improving the productivity of these resources. Waste materials and energy should become input for other processes through waste valorization: either as a component for another industrial process or as regenerative resources for nature (e.g., compost). The Ellen MacArthur Foundation (EMF) defines the circular economy as an industrial economy that is restorative or regenerative by value and design.<END_CTX><START_A>A circular economy focuses on the principles of eliminating waste and pollution, circulating products and materials, and the regeneration of nature. Though the term large language model has no formal definition, it often refers to deep learning models having a parameter count on the order of billions or more. LLMs are general purpose models which excel at a wide range of tasks, as opposed to being trained for one specific task (such as sentiment analysis, named entity recognition, or mathematical reasoning). The skill with which they accomplish tasks, and the range of tasks at which they are capable, seems to be a function of the amount of resources (data, parameter-size, computing power) devoted to them, in a way that is not dependent on additional breakthroughs in design.
Though trained on simple tasks along the lines of predicting the next word in a sentence, neural language models with sufficient training and parameter counts are found to capture much of the syntax and semantics of human language. In addition, large language models demonstrate considerable general knowledge about the world, and are able to "memorize" a great quantity of facts during training.

Large language models have most commonly used the transformer architecture, which, since 2018, has become the standard deep learning technique for sequential data (previously, recurrent architectures such as the LSTM were most common). LLMs are trained in an unsupervised manner on unannotated text. A left-to-right transformer is trained to maximize the probability assigned to the next word in the training data, given the previous context. Alternatively, an LLM may use a bidirectional transformer (as in the example of BERT), which assigns a probability distribution over words given access to both preceding and following context. In addition to the task of predicting the next word or "filling in the blanks", LLMs may be trained on auxiliary tasks which test their understanding of the data distribution such as Next Sentence Prediction (NSP), in which pairs of sentences are presented and the model must predict whether they appear side-by-side in the training corpus.
The earliest LLMs were trained on corpora having on the order of billions of words. The first model in OpenAI's GPT series was trained in 2018 on BookCorpus, consisting of 985 million words. In the same year, BERT was trained on a combination of BookCorpus and English Wikipedia, totalling 3.3 billion words. In the years since then, training corpora for LLMs have increased by orders of magnitude, reaching up to hundreds of billions or trillions of tokens.
LLMs are computationally expensive to train. A 2020 study estimated the cost of training a 1.5 billion parameter model (1-2 orders of magnitude smaller than the state of the art at the time) at $1.6 million.
A 2020 analysis found that neural language models' capability (as measured by training loss) increased smoothly in a power law relationship with number of parameters, quantity of training data, and computation used for training. These relationships were tested over a wide range of values (up to seven orders of magnitude) and no attenuation of the relationship was observed at the highest end of the range (including for network sizes up to trillions of parameters).

Between 2018 and 2020, the standard method for harnessing an LLM for a specific natural language processing (NLP) task was to fine tune the model with additional task-specific training. It has subsequently been found that more powerful LLMs such as GPT-3 can solve tasks without additional training via "prompting" techniques, in which the problem to be solved is presented to the model as a text prompt, possibly with some textual examples of similar problems and their solutions.
Fine-tuning
Main article: Fine-tuning (machine learning)
Fine-tuning is the practice of modifying an existing pretrained language model by training it (in a supervised fashion) on a specific task (e.g. sentiment analysis, named entity recognition, or part-of-speech tagging). It is a form of transfer learning. It generally involves the introduction of a new set of weights connecting the final layer of the language model to the output of the downstream task. The original weights of the language model may be "frozen", such that only the new layer of weights connecting them to the output are learned during training. Alternatively, the original weights may receive small updates (possibly with earlier layers frozen).

Instruction tuning is a form of fine-tuning designed to facilitate more natural and accurate zero-shot prompting interactions. Given a text input, a pretrained language model will generate a completion which matches the distribution of text on which it was trained. A naive language model given the prompt "Write an essay about the main themes of Hamlet." might provide a completion such as "A late penalty of 10% per day will be applied to submissions received after March 17." In instruction tuning, the language model is trained on many examples of tasks formulated as natural language instructions, along with appropriate responses. Various techniques for instruction tuning have been applied in practice. OpenAI's InstructGPT protocol involves supervised fine-tuning on a dataset of human-generated (prompt, response) pairs, followed by reinforcement learning from human feedback (RLHF), in which a reward function was learned based on a dataset of human preferences. Another technique, "self-instruct", fine-tunes the language model on a training set of examples which are themselves generated by an LLM (bootstrapped from a small initial set of human-generated examples).

The plan was a five-stage race from 31 May to 5 July, starting in Paris and stopping in Lyon, Marseille, Bordeaux, and Nantes before returning to Paris. Toulouse was added later to break the long haul across southern France from the Mediterranean to the Atlantic. Stages would go through the night and finish next afternoon, with rest days before riders set off again. But this proved too daunting and the costs too great for most and only 15 competitors had entered. Desgrange had never been wholly convinced and he came close to dropping the idea. Instead, he cut the length to 19 days, changed the dates to 1 to 19 July, and offered a daily allowance to those who averaged at least 20 kilometres per hour (12 mph) on all the stages, equivalent to what a rider would have expected to earn each day had he worked in a factory. He also cut the entry fee from 20 to 10 francs and set the first prize at 12,000 francs and the prize for each day's winner at 3,000 francs. The winner would thereby win six times what most workers earned in a year. That attracted between 60 and 80 entrants – the higher number may have included serious inquiries and some who dropped out – among them not just professionals but amateurs, some unemployed, and some simply adventurous.
Desgrange seems not to have forgotten the Dreyfus Affair that launched his race and raised the passions of his backers. He announced his new race on 1 July 1903 by citing the writer Émile Zola, whose open letter J'Accuse…! led to Dreyfus's acquittal, establishing the florid style he used henceforth.
The first Tour de France started almost outside the Café Reveil-Matin at the junction of the Melun and Corbeil roads in the village of Montgeron. It was waved away by the starter, Georges Abran, at 3:16 p.m. on 1 July 1903. L'Auto hadn't featured the race on its front page that morning.[n 3]
Among the competitors were the eventual winner, Maurice Garin, his well-built rival Hippolyte Aucouturier, the German favourite Josef Fischer, and a collection of adventurers, including one competing as "Samson".[n 4]
Many riders dropped out of the race after completing the initial stages, as the physical effort the tour required was just too much. Only a mere 24 entrants remained at the end of the fourth stage. The race finished on the edge of Paris at Ville d'Avray, outside the Restaurant du Père Auto, before a ceremonial ride into Paris and several laps of the Parc des Princes. Garin dominated the race, winning the first and last two stages, at 25.68 kilometres per hour (15.96 mph). The last rider, Millocheau, finished 64h 47m 22s behind him.
L'Auto's mission was accomplished, as circulation of the publication doubled throughout the race, making the race something much larger than Desgrange had ever hoped for.<END_CTX><START_A>The first race in 1903 was won by Maurice Garin, over his rival Hippolyte Aucouturier<END_A> |

Adding a liquid fabric softener to the final rinse (rinse-cycle softener) results in laundry that feels softer. | Machine washing puts great mechanical stress on textiles, so adding a liquid fabric softener to the final rinse results in laundry that feels softer. | information_extraction | <START_INST>Why should I use fabric softener?<END_INST><START_CTX>Machine washing puts great mechanical stress on textiles, particularly natural fibers such as cotton and wool. The fibers at the fabric surface are squashed and frayed, and this condition hardens while drying the laundry in air, giving the laundry a harsh feel. Adding a liquid fabric softener to the final rinse (rinse-cycle softener) results in laundry that feels softer.<END_CTX><START_A>Machine washing puts great mechanical stress on textiles, so adding a liquid fabric softener to the final rinse results in laundry that feels softer.<END_A> |

Together with ancient Egypt and Mesopotamia, it was one of three early civilisations of the Near East and South Asia, and of the three, the most widespread. Its sites spanned an area from much of Pakistan, to northeast Afghanistan, and northwestern India. The civilisation flourished both in the alluvial plain of the Indus River, which flows through the length of Pakistan, and along a system of perennial monsoon-fed rivers that once coursed in the vicinity of the Ghaggar-Hakra, a seasonal river in northwest India and eastern Pakistan.
The term Harappan is sometimes applied to the Indus civilisation after its type site Harappa, the first to be excavated early in the 20th century in what was then the Punjab province of British India and is now Punjab, Pakistan. The discovery of Harappa and soon afterwards Mohenjo-daro was the culmination of work that had begun after the founding of the Archaeological Survey of India in the British Raj in 1861. There were earlier and later cultures called Early Harappan and Late Harappan in the same area. The early Harappan cultures were populated from Neolithic cultures, the earliest and best-known of which is Mehrgarh, in Balochistan, Pakistan. Harappan civilisation is sometimes called Mature Harappan to distinguish it from the earlier cultures.
The cities of the ancient Indus were noted for their urban planning, baked brick houses, elaborate drainage systems, water supply systems, clusters of large non-residential buildings, and techniques of handicraft and metallurgy. Mohenjo-daro and Harappa very likely grew to contain between 30,000 and 60,000 individuals, and the civilisation may have contained between one and five million individuals during its florescence. A gradual drying of the region during the 3rd millennium BCE may have been the initial stimulus for its urbanisation. Eventually it also reduced the water supply enough to cause the civilisation's demise and to disperse its population to the east.
Although over a thousand Mature Harappan sites have been reported and nearly a hundred excavated, there are five major urban centres: Mohenjo-daro in the lower Indus Valley (declared a UNESCO World Heritage Site in 1980 as "Archaeological Ruins at Moenjodaro"), Harappa in the western Punjab region, Ganeriwala in the Cholistan Desert, Dholavira in western Gujarat (declared a UNESCO World Heritage Site in 2021 as "Dholavira: A Harappan City"), and Rakhigarhi in Haryana. The Harappan language is not directly attested, and its affiliation uncertain as the Indus script has remained undeciphered. A relationship with the Dravidian or Elamo-Dravidian language family is favoured by a section of scholars.<END_CTX><START_A>Indus Valley Civilization at its peak had a population between one and five million people.<END_A> |
